About the Role
As our Loyalty Product Manager, you’ll shape the strategy, roadmap, and evolution of our digital loyalty platform. You’ll lead capability development, guide customer‑journey design, and ensure we deliver personalized, meaningful, and scalable loyalty experiences across all MOL Group markets.
This role combines strategic product leadership, deep loyalty expertise, and hands‑on collaboration across marketing, technology, data, and vendor partners.
If you love building customer value, influencing product direction, and working on high‑impact digital platforms – you’ll feel right at home.
Key Responsibilities
  • Define and execute the product strategy for MOL’s digital loyalty platform
  • Drive capability development, including personalization, gamification, mobility integration, and ecosystem features
  • Shape long‑term product vision with senior stakeholders and translate business goals into product outcomes
  • Lead feature discovery: define user needs, system behavior, customer journeys, and experience flows
  • Build and maintain a multi‑year product roadmap – prioritizing based on impact, feasibility, and market trends
  • Run MVPs, pilots, and experiments to validate ideas and accelerate learning
  • Own the product backlog: write clear requirements, user stories, and acceptance criteria
  • Analyze industry trends, customer insights, and competitive benchmarks to drive innovation
  • Partner with technology teams to ensure scalable delivery and high‑quality execution
  • Own product KPIs and measure impact using analytics, insights, and customer feedback
  • Manage cross‑functional communication, alignment, demos, and stakeholder updates
  • Act as budget owner for product development and vendor collaboration
  • Lead and mentor thematic product leads (1–5 direct reports)
  • Contribute to the overall Digital Factory strategy and represent loyalty in cross‑functional forums
  • Develop strong knowledge of Salesforce (Marketing Cloud, Loyalty, Data Cloud) to guide future capability expansion
